Flood water pounding against a canyon wall and wearing it down is an example of....

Answer:

The correct answer is a) Weathering.

     

Explanation:

Weathering refers to the process of separating minerals, rocks, or other compounds through contact with the atmosphere or water, which is why it is divided into chemical and physical weathering.

For example, in the case of floodwater hitting against the canyon wall, it is known as a physical weathering, since hitting the water in the canyon produces a break in the rocks, this does not affect the chemical composition of the rocks alone its physical structure since the rock is breaking into smaller pieces by the blow of the water.
